Step 1: Define Your Objectives
Before diving into the design, it’s essential to understand what you want to achieve with your appointment application form. Consider the following questions:
- What information do you need from the applicant?
- How will this information be used?
- What is the primary goal of the form (e.g., to schedule an initial consultation, collect leads, etc.)?
Step 2: Plan Your Form Structure
A well-structured form is easy to navigate and encourages completion. Here’s how to plan your form structure:
a. Determine the Necessary Fields
List all the information you require from applicants. Common fields include:
- Personal Information: Full name, contact details (phone number, email address).
- Appointment Details: Desired date and time, service type, location.
- Additional Information: Preferences, special requirements, etc.
b. Organize the Fields Logically
Group related fields together and ensure the flow of the form is logical. For example, personal information should come before appointment details.
c. Prioritize Fields
Not all fields are equally important. Prioritize essential fields (like name and contact details) and make them mandatory. Less critical fields can be optional.
Step 3: Design the Form Layout
A visually appealing form enhances user experience. Here’s how to design your form layout:
a. Choose a Clean and Professional Template
Select a template that aligns with your brand’s image. Ensure it’s mobile-friendly, as many users will access the form on their smartphones.
b. Use Clear and Consistent Formatting
Consistent font styles, colors, and sizes make the form more readable. Use headings, subheadings, and bullet points to organize information.
c. Provide Spacing and White Space
Avoid cluttering the form. Adequate spacing and white space make the form look more inviting and easier to complete.
Step 4: Implement User-Friendly Features
To ensure a smooth user experience, incorporate the following features:
a. Input Validation
Validate user inputs in real-time to prevent errors. For example, ensure email addresses are in the correct format and phone numbers contain the correct number of digits.
b. Clear Instructions
Provide clear instructions for each field, especially for fields with specific formatting requirements.
c. Error Messages
If an error is detected, display a clear and concise error message that guides the user on how to correct it.
Step 5: Test the Form
Before launching the form, thoroughly test it to ensure it works as intended. Here’s what to check:
a. Functionality
Ensure all fields, buttons, and validation rules work correctly.
b. User Experience
Complete the form as a user would and identify any usability issues.
c. Performance
Test the form on different devices and browsers to ensure compatibility.
Step 6: Integrate with Your System
Once the form is tested and working correctly, integrate it with your existing systems. This may include:
a. CRM Integration
Connect the form to your Customer Relationship Management (CRM) system to automatically capture new leads.
b. Email Notifications
Set up email notifications to alert you when a new appointment application is submitted.
c. Payment Integration (if applicable)
If you require payment for appointments, integrate a payment gateway to process transactions securely.
Step 7: Monitor and Improve
After the form is live, monitor its performance and gather feedback from users. Use this information to make improvements and optimize the form for better results.
